It became known today that index of business activity in industry of Switzerland declined to 59.6 points in December against the forecast of 61 points and the previous value of 61.8 points.
According to the data released at the end of December, KOF indicator in Switzerland fell to the level of 2.10 in December against its previous value of 2.13; however it still remains at a high level, confirming the belief that country’s economy continues to recover.
The boost in the Eurozone, in Germany in particular helps to normalize the levels of exports in Switzerland, however the world’s economists think that country‘s economy can slow down in 2011, largely due to the strong CHF. We would remind that Franc broke a new historical record in pairing with the USD in the last days of December 20120.
According to KOF estimates (Swiss institute of research on economic cycles) Swiss Franc will retain the status of a protective asset and a refuge as long as the period of tension will be maintained in Europe.
KOF has also revised its forecast for GDP growth upward in 2011; is it projected that Swiss economy will increase by 1.9% in 2011 against the previous forecast of 1.8%. In 1012 national economy is expected to rise by 2%.
Interest rate in Switzerland (Libor) is currently in the target level of 0-0.75%; the next meeting of the Swiss National Bank is scheduled for 17 March. Subsequent meeting of 2011 will be held on 16 June, 15 September, 15 December.
